Cable Vibration Mitigation Technology in Cable-stayed Bridges provides an overview of research and engineering practice on stay cable vibration control. It provides a systematic introduction to stay cable vibration issues, commonly used mitigation measures, vibration control system design theories, related technologies, and the latest trends in the field. It includes detailed case studies of the initial vibration mitigation design for various bridges and the subsequent upgrades to their vibration control systems; the book provides a comprehensive overview of the stay cable vibration control design process, device selection and testing, vibration mitigation performance evaluation, and the emerging challenges and solutions for ultra-long stay cables in long-span cable-stayed bridges
- Provides an overview of the basic analytical models and vibration types of stay cables
- Reviews aerodynamic measures, mechanical dampers and cross-ties for cable vibration reduction, and the corresponding methods for theoretical modelling and vibration control design
- Provides an analysis of the performance testing of stay cable dampers, damping measurements, and long-term monitoring of cable vibrations and damper performance
